Broken Sword 4 Box Art | 12 Jul 2006

Written by steve
14 Comments

Discshop.se have given us the first view of the box art for Broken Sword: The Angel of Death.

Broken Sword 4 Box Art

Looking at the box art, we can see a few things. First, it looks like it's going to be DVD only. Whether this indicates Discshop aren't selling the CDROM version, or if a CDROM version exists at all remains to be seen.

Next, we see the game is rated 12+ through PEGI, so it's the European version of the box art. It might be different for other regions like Broken Sword 3 was.

Nico, George and Anna Maria are present on the cover (as well as the ominous Angel of Death above their heads), possibly showing that Anna Maria will have an equal role to Nico and George in this game.

Finally, we see it's "A Game By Charles Cecil". Quite specific, rather than just branding it with the Revolution Software logo, don't you think?
